Meta has introduced Muse Code (Beta), its first AI coding agent, alongside Muse Spark 1.2, an upgraded coding model designed to power the new platform, marking another major step in the company’s push to accelerate AI-driven software engineering.
The announcement was made by Meta Chief Executive Officer, Mark Zuckerberg, who said the latest releases demonstrate the company’s rapid pace of innovation across its artificial intelligence stack.
The launch comes just one month after the release of Muse Spark 1.1, underscoring Meta’s commitment to continuously improving its AI models and developer tools. Both Muse Code and Muse Spark 1.2 are now available to developers worldwide through expanded access on the Meta Model API.
Muse Code is a terminal-based AI coding agent that enables developers to execute complex software engineering tasks using natural-language instructions. Rather than simply generating code, the system can plan projects, write code, run tests, verify outputs, and manage entire code repositories with minimal human intervention.
A standout feature of Muse Code is its multi-agent architecture, which allows multiple AI agents to work in parallel on different aspects of a project, significantly reducing development time for complex engineering tasks.
Meta said the tool can be installed with a single command and will be offered under two pricing tiers, including an optional contributor plan designed to provide more affordable access for developers.
Complementing the coding agent is Muse Spark 1.2, an upgraded AI model co-trained with Muse Code to deliver tighter integration and improved coding performance. According to Meta, the new model offers higher first-attempt success rates, cleaner code execution, and reduces the need for repeated prompts.
Designed specifically for long-running, multi-file software development projects, Muse Spark 1.2 features a one-million-token context window, enabling it to process and understand significantly larger codebases than previous versions.
Meta described the model as highly competitive and said it represents another milestone in the company’s journey toward developing frontier AI models. The company also hinted that even larger and more capable AI models are currently in development.
